No. Meet our minimum math requirement by demonstrating a mastery of Algebra II in high school, or Intermediate Algebra in college with a grade of C or better. An articulation history is a list of classes at a particular school which have historically transferred for credit at USC. These lists indicate the community college courses that fulfill General Education and other requirements, as well as equivalents to lower-division courses at USC. You can take GEs to fill in your schedule (you want to make sure you are taking a full load of courses each semester), but we are much more concerned with math and science courses. Duplicated material: An AP exam and IB exam or college course covering the same material.
